• Sigma
  • Dec 25, 2025
  • Web Development

How to Appear on Google Maps

If you own a shop, café, office, or service-based business in Malta, appearing on Google Maps is no longer optional — it is essential. When people search for phrases like “near me,” “shop in Valletta,” or “best service in Sliema,” Google Maps results are often the first thing they see.

In this guide, we will explain how to get your shop listed on Google Maps in Malta, how to optimize it for visibility, and how local SEO strategies can help you attract more customers and foot traffic.

At Boost Digital Force, we help Maltese businesses improve their local presence using proven SEO and digital marketing strategies. Let’s break it down step by step.

1. Why Google Maps Matters for Businesses in Malta

Google Maps is one of the most powerful tools for local discovery. For local businesses in Malta, it directly impacts:

  • Walk-in customers
  • Phone calls and directions
  • Local trust and credibility
  • Online visibility in competitive areas like Sliema, St Julian’s, Birkirkara, and Valletta

Studies consistently show that businesses appearing in the top 3 Google Map results receive the majority of clicks and visits. If your shop is not listed or not optimized, you are losing potential customers to competitors.

2. Create or Claim Your Google Business Profile

The first and most important step is setting up a Google Business Profile (formerly Google My Business).

How to do it:

  1. Go to Google and search for your business name.
  2. If it appears, claim it. If not, create a new listing.
  3. Enter accurate business information:
    • Business name (no keyword stuffing)
    • Address in Malta
    • Phone number
    • Website URL
    • Business category

Accuracy is critical. Your business name, address, and phone number must be consistent across your website and other platforms.

If you need help setting this up professionally, our SEO Analytics service ensures your listing is correctly configured and optimized from the start.

3. Verify Your Business Location

Google requires verification to confirm that your business is real and located where you claim. In Malta, this usually involves:

  • Postcard verification (sent to your address)
  • Phone or email verification (in some cases)

Once verified, your shop becomes eligible to appear on Google Maps and local search results.

4. Optimize Your Google Maps Listing for Local SEO

Simply appearing on Google Maps is not enough. Optimization is what helps your shop rank higher.

Key optimization steps:

  • Add a keyword-rich business description (naturally written)
  • Upload high-quality photos of your shop, interior, and products
  • Add opening hours and special holiday hours
  • Enable messaging and booking (if relevant)
  • Choose the most accurate primary and secondary categories

For example, instead of just “Shop,” choose “Clothing Store in Malta” or “Electronics Repair Service.”

A well-optimized listing sends strong relevance signals to Google.

5. Use Local Keywords on Your Website

Your website plays a major role in Google Maps rankings. Google cross-checks your website content with your Maps listing.

You should include:

  • Location-based keywords (e.g. “Digital Agency in Malta”)
  • Dedicated location pages if you serve multiple areas
  • Embedded Google Maps on your contact page

A technically strong website also improves trust and ranking. Our Web Development services ensure your site is fast, mobile-friendly, and optimized for local search.

6. Get Reviews from Real Customers

Customer reviews are one of the strongest ranking factors for Google Maps.

Best practices:

  • Ask satisfied customers to leave a review
  • Respond to all reviews (positive and negative)
  • Use natural language — never fake reviews
  • Encourage reviews that mention your service and location

For example:
“Great service, very professional shop in Sliema, Malta.”

Consistent reviews improve visibility and increase trust with potential customers.

7. Build Local Citations in Malta

Local citations are mentions of your business on directories and platforms such as:

  • Local business directories
  • Industry-specific websites
  • Social media profiles

Your NAP information (Name, Address, Phone) must be identical everywhere. Inconsistencies can hurt your rankings.

This is where professional local SEO management becomes valuable. Our Better Audiences approach ensures your business is correctly positioned across trusted platforms.

8. Add Regular Updates and Photos

Google favors active businesses. Posting updates signals that your shop is open and engaged.

You can:

  • Post offers or promotions
  • Share news or events
  • Upload new photos regularly

Businesses that update their profiles often rank higher than inactive listings.

9. Use Paid Ads to Support Google Maps Visibility

For competitive areas in Malta, organic visibility may take time. Google Ads with location targeting can help support faster exposure.

Local search ads can:

  • Appear above map results
  • Drive immediate calls and directions
  • Complement long-term SEO strategies

Our Dynamic Banner Advertising and paid marketing services help accelerate visibility while SEO builds sustainable results.

10. Track Performance and Improve Continuously

Once your shop appears on Google Maps, tracking performance is crucial.

Monitor:

  • Search impressions
  • Calls and direction requests
  • Website clicks
  • Review growth

Data-driven improvements help maintain and improve rankings over time. Our SEO Analytics solutions provide actionable insights to refine your local strategy.

Conclusion

Getting your shop on Google Maps in Malta is one of the most effective ways to attract local customers, increase visibility, and grow your business. However, true success comes from proper setup, ongoing optimization, strong reviews, and local SEO alignment.

At Boost Digital Force, we help Maltese businesses stand out in Google Maps and local search results through strategic SEO, web development, and digital marketing solutions.

Explore our Services to learn how we can support your business, and read more insights on our Blog.



1. How do I add my business to Google Maps in Malta?

Create or claim your Google Business Profile, enter accurate business details, and complete the verification process.

2. Is Google Maps free for businesses in Malta?

Yes, creating and managing a Google Business Profile is completely free.

3. How long does it take for a shop to appear on Google Maps?

After verification, most businesses appear within a few days, though ranking improvements may take several weeks.

4. What helps my business rank higher on Google Maps?

Accurate information, customer reviews, local keywords, website optimization, and regular profile updates.

5. Do I need a website to appear on Google Maps?

A website is not mandatory, but having one significantly improves credibility and local SEO performance.